El diseo grfico en Linux El Escritorio GNU/Linux Linux sobre mquinas virtuales Automatizacin de tareas Configuracin bsica de una LAN en Linux Servicio de IRC en Linux Linux y el Proxy OpenOffice Ventajas e inconvenientes de Linux La Shell de GNU/Linux Primera Sesin: Comenzando por las opciones bsicas. Segunda Sesin: Permisos y Usuarios Tercera Sesin: Archivos comprimidos en Linux Sistema operativo Linux
Qu es Linux?
LINUX (o GNU/LINUX, ms correctamente) es un Sistema Operativo como MacOS, DOS o
Windows. Es decir, Linux es el software necesario para que tu ordenador te permita utilizar programas como: editores de texto, juegos, navegadores de Internet, etc. Linux puede usarse mediante un interfaz grfico al igual que Windows o MacOS, pero tambin puede usarse mediante lnea de comandos como DOS. Linux tiene su origen en Unix. ste apareci en los aos sesenta, desarrollado por los investigadores Dennis Ritchie y Ken Thompson, de los Laboratorios Telefnicos Bell. Andrew Tanenbaum desarroll un sistema operativo parecido a Unix (llamado Minix) para ensear a sus alumnos el diseo de un sistema operativo. Debido al enfoque docente de Minix, Tanenbaum nunca permiti que ste fuera modificado, ya que podran introducirse complicaciones en el sistema para sus alumnos. Un estudiante finlands llamado Linus Torvalds, constatando que no era posible extender Minix, decidi derftgjnhmkm hgredi aprovechar el sistema GNU y completarlo con su propio ncleo, que bautiz como Linux (Linux Is Not UniX). El sistema conjunto (herramientas GNU y ncleo Linux) forma lo que llamamos GNU/Linux. El ncleo de Linux Una pregunta muy comn es: qu es el ncleo de Linux?. La respuesta es: Linux. En las lneas anteriores ya se da una primera definicin del ncleo: el kernel o ncleo, que controla elhardware. Es decir, el ncleo de Linux, simplificando, es un conjunto de drivers necesarios para usar el ordenador. Relativamente, poco hardware se escapar a un kernel actualizado. En este momento, la ltima versin del kernel de Linux es la 4.2. Para descargar la ltima versin o ver por cul va, puede visitar la pgina oficial del kernel de Linux. Historia de Linux LINUX hace su aparicion a principios de la decada de los noventa, era el ao 1991 y por aquel entonces un estudiante de informatica de la Universidad de Helsinki, llamado Linus Torvalds, empez como una aficin y sin poderse imaginar a lo que llegaria este proyecto, a programar las primeras lineas de codigo de este sistema operativo llamado LINUX. Este comienzo estuvo inspirado en MINIX, un pequeo sistema Unix desarrollado por Andy Tanenbaum. Las primeras discusiones sobre Linux fueron en el grupo de noticias comp.os.minix, en estas discusiones se hablaba sobre todo del desarrollo de un pequeo sistema Unix para usuarios de Minix que querian mas. Linus nunca anunci la version 0.01 de Linux (agosto 1991), esta version no era ni siquiera ejecutable, solamente incluia los principios del nucleo del sistema, estaba escrita en lenguaje ensamblador y asuma que uno tena acceso a un sistema Minix para su compilacin. El 5 de octubre de 1991, Linus anuncio la primera version "Oficial" de Linux version 0.02. Con esta version Linus pudo ejecutar Bash (GNU Bourne Again Shell) y gcc (El compilador GNU de C) pero no mucho mas funcionaba. En este estado de desarrollo ni se pensaba en los terminos soporte, documentacion, distribucin. Despus de la version 0.03, Linus salt en la numeracin hasta la 0.10, mas y mas programadores a lo largo y ancho de internet empezaron a trabajar en el proyecto y despus de sucesivas revisiones, Linus incremento el numero de version hasta la 0.95 (Marzo 1992). Mas de un ao despues (diciembre 1993) el ncleo del sistema estaba en la version 0.99 y la version 1.0 no llego hasta el 14 de marzo de 1994. Desde entonces no se ha parado de desarrollar, la version actual del ncleo es la 2.2 y sigue avanzando da a da con la meta de perfeccionar y mejorar el sistema. Distribuciones populares Entre las distribuciones Linux ms populares estn: Arch Linux, una distribucin basada en el principio KISS, con un sistema de desarrollo continuo entre cada versin (no es necesario volver a instalar todo el sistema para actualizarlo). Canaima, es un proyecto socio-tecnolgico abierto, construido de forma colaborativa, desarrollado en Venezuela y basado en Debian. CentOS, una distribucin creada a partir del mismo cdigo del sistema Red Hat pero mantenida por una comunidad de desarrolladores voluntarios. Chakra project, una popular distribucin para escritorio, inicialmente basada en Arch Linux, actualmente se encuentra en un desarrollo independiente. Debian, una distribucin mantenida por una red de desarrolladores voluntarios con un gran compromiso por los principios del software libre. Dragora y Trisquel, que van adquiriendo importancia entre las distribuciones que slo contienen software libre. Elementary OS Es una distribucin Linux basada en Ubuntu 12.04 Fedora, una distribucin lanzada por Red Hat para la comunidad. Fuduntu, distribucin ligera y rpida basada en Fedora y orientada al uso en notebooks. Gentoo, una distribucin orientada a usuarios avanzados, conocida por la similitud en su sistema de paquetes con el FreeBSD Ports, un sistema que automatiza la compilacin de aplicaciones desde su cdigo fuente. Huayra, distribucin Educativa, desarrollada por el estado Argentino, desde el Anses /Programa Conectar Igualdad. Est basada en Debian Jessie con entorno de escritorio MATE. Knoppix, fue la primera distribucin live en correr completamente desde un medio extrable. Est basada en Debian. Kubuntu, la versin en KDE de Ubuntu. Linux Mint, una popular distribucin derivada de Ubuntu. Mageia, creada por ex trabajadores de Mandriva, muy parecida a su precursor. Mandriva, mantenida por la compaa francesa del mismo nombre, es un sistema popular en Francia y Brasil. Est basada en Red Hat. openSUSE, originalmente basada en Slackware es patrocinada actualmente por la compaa SUSE (Micro Focus International). PCLinuxOS, derivada de Mandriva, pas de ser un pequeo proyecto a una popular distribucin con una gran comunidad de desarrolladores. Puppy Linux, versin para equipos antiguos o con pocos recursos que pesa unos 130 MiB. Red Hat Enterprise Linux, derivada de Fedora, es mantenida y soportada comercialmente por Red Hat. Slackware, una de las primeras distribuciones Linux y la ms antigua en funcionamiento. Fue fundada en 1993 y desde entonces ha sido mantenida activamente por Patrick J. Volkerding. Slax, es un sistema Linux pequeo, moderno, rpido y portable orientado a la modularidad. Est basado en Slackware. Tuquito Basada en Ubuntu, distribucin desarrollada en Argentina con buenas interfaces grficas y drivers universales. Recomendada para usuarios iniciales. Trisquel Distribucin 100 % libre, utiliza el ncleo Linux-Libre y es apropiada para usuarios finales. Ubuntu, una popular distribucin para escritorio basada en Debian y mantenida por Canonical. Zorin OS, distribucin basada en Ubuntu y orientada a los usuarios de Windows que quieren pasar a Linux de la forma ms fcil y sencilla posible. El sitio web DistroWatch ofrece una lista de las distribuciones ms populares; la lista est basada principalmente en el nmero de visitas, por lo que no ofrece resultados muy confiables acerca de la popularidad de las distribuciones. Distribuciones especializadas Distribuciones especializadas en grupos especficos: 64 Studio, una distribucin basada en Debian diseada para la edicin multimedia. ABC GNU/Linux, distribucin para la construccin de clusters Beowulf desarrollado por Iker Castaos Chavarri, Universidad del Pas Vasco. Kali Linux, distribucin basada en Debian y especializada en seguridad de red. BackTrack, distribucin basada en Ubuntu y especializada en seguridad de red. WiFiSlax, distribucin basada en Slackware y especializada en seguridad de red. Wifiway, distribucin basada en Ubuntu y especializada en seguridad de red. Debian Med, Debian Med es una distro orientada a la prctica mdica y a la investigacin bio- mdica. Edubuntu, un sistema del proyecto Ubuntu diseado para entornos educativos. Emmabunts, es diseada para facilitar el reacondicionamiento de computadores donados a comunidades Emas. Fedora Electronic Lab, distribucin basada en Fedora y especializada en el desarrollo electrnico. GeeXbox, distribucin rpida y ligera orientada a los centros multimedia. ICABIAN, en formato Live USB est pensada para usuarios tcnicos ya que contiene una gran variedad de programas para la ciencia e ingeniera. LULA, distribucin acadmica para universidades. Proyecto LULA. mkLinux, Yellow Dog Linux o Black Lab Linux, orientadas a usuarios de Macintosh y de la plataforma PowerPC. Musix, una distribucin de Argentina destinada a los msicos. MythTV, orientada para equipos multimedia o grabadores de vdeo digital. OpenWrt, diseada para ser empotrada en dispositivos enrutadores. Scientific Linux, distribucin para desarrollo cientfico basada en Red Hat. UberStudent, distribucin dedicada a la educacin y basada en Ubuntu. Noticias
Microsoft SQL Server llegar a GNU/Linux en 2017
No, no se trata de una broma a destiempo del da de los inocentes, SQL Server tendr una versin para GNU/Linux, algo confirmado por la misma Microsoft en su blog oficial. SQL Server es un sistema gestor de bases de datos relacionales desarrollada por el gigante de Redmond, siendo una solucin muy popular dentro de este segmento. Sin embargo desde siempre ha mostrado una clara desventaja frente a sus competidores debido a que solo funciona sobre sistemas operativos Windows, algo que cambiar dentro de un tiempo. Como est siendo habitual en los ltimos tiempos con hechos como la liberalizacin del cdigo de .NET y la llegada de algunos productos como Visual Studio Code, este movimiento es otro ms en el proceso de transformacin que est viviendo Microsoft, un proceso que segn su actual CEO, Satya Nadella, est convirtiendo los datos en el principal activo. Nuestro activo ms estratgico no es servir sistemas operativos. Leer ms Sistemas de domtica basados en Linux La domtica cada vez se extiende ms para hacer que nuestro hogares sean ms inteligentes y nos faciliten la vida. Silk Labs ha iniciado una campaa en KickStarter para el crowdfounding de su nuevo producto domtico llamado Sense. Se trata de una cmara de vigilancia, con dotes de automatizacin, reconocimiento de voz, reconocimiento facial y de gestos, dotada de IA (Inteligencia Artificial) para realizar su cometido. Silk Labs pretende encontrar el xito con su producto para la domtica hogarea gracias a la cmara Smart Sense y que se basa en Linux. El producto estar disponible en marzo, el 17 concretamente y por un precio de 249$, as podrn financiar el desarrollo y finalmente ser lanzado al mercado en diciembre de este ao, si toda la campaa va bien. Y todo gracias al trabajo de la compaa Silk Labs que tom esta idea el pasado ao para crear este novedoso producto. Silk Labs naci del ex CTO de Mozilla Andreas Gal, junto con otros compaeros como Chris Jones, quien tambin fue desarrollador del sistema operativo Firefox OS, al que se le uni Michael Vines, otro reputado del mundo tecnolgico, ya que fue director de tecnologa en la gran compaa Qualcomm. Sin duda, Mozilla y Qualcomm son dos grandes del mundo de las nuevas tecnologas y que gracias a ellos, y a los que han querido financiar esta campaa, podremos disfrutar de Sense pronto. Leer ms El pirata que atac el portal de Linux Mint explica como lo hizo Ya anunciamos en este blog que haba atacado los servidores de Linux Mint para sustituir las imgenes ISO de la famosa distribucin Linux por otras modificadas que haba creado este pirata. As, todos los que han descargado la ISO de la distribucin Linux Mint, habrn instalado en su mquina una versin que no es la original y que ha sido manipulada. Por el momento se saba del ataque pero no se saba del responsable, ahora ya se conoce el atacante que incluso ha explicado cmo lo hizo. Adems, el pirata alega que no solo afect a las imgenes ISO de la zona de descargas del portal oficial de Linux Mint, tambin a otras partes como los foros, pudiendo tener acceso a los nombres de usuario y contraseas de todos los registrados. Algo que es un fallo de seguridad bastante grave. Disponer de usuarios y contraseas de un registro en un foro quizs no sea lo ms grave, pero s poder modificar las ISOs para que los usuarios descarguen distros modificadas con un fin (instalar un backdoor o puerta trasera para tener acceso al equipo vctima a su antojo